Copper-doped Lithium Niobate (Cu:LiNbO3) is a type of lithium niobate crystal with a small amount of copper (Cu) ions substituted for lithium ions. The addition of copper ions affects the optical and electronic properties of the crystal, making it useful for various photonic and optoelectronic applications.
Cu:LiNbO3 is known for its high nonlinear optical coefficients, making it useful for frequency conversion and other nonlinear optical processes. It is also widely used as a modulator material in optical communication systems. In addition, the piezoelectric properties of Cu:LiNbO3 allow it to be used for transducer applications.
The combination of the nonlinear, piezoelectric, and optical properties of Cu:LiNbO3 make it a versatile and valuable material in the field of photonics and optoelectronics.
